Hobie Cat Trampoline Cupholder

Short and simple, it's a cup holder for your classically-trampolined Hobie cats with the lacing between two separate halves of the trampoline. I haven't designed it to accommodate coozies, but if there's demand I'm happy to modify this design and post it, probably as V4b or something.

Requires


4x M4x0.7-30 Flat head screws

4x M4x0.7 nuts (nut pockets deep enough for complete thread engagement with nylocks)

Istrongly suggest using 316 stainless hardware here. It is the most commonly available stainless that I'm aware of that has added molybdenum, which makes it considerably more rust resistant and genuinely stainless than most other common steel alloys.

Specifically, I will recommend the following McMaster part numbers: 91801A680 316 Stainless Steel Phillips Flat Head Screws 94205A230 316 Stainless Steel Nylon-Insert Locknut

Of course, whatever you find that's equivalent to this and cheaper is also good. I use Fastenal and my local Tacoma Screw for this sort of thing all the time.

Features


It's a cup holder. it holds standard cans. The internal diameter is 2.65 inches.

Print Settings

Printer Brand:

Creality

Printer:

CR-10S

Rafts:

No

Supports:

Yes

Resolution:

0.2mm

Infill:

I think 15%? You could probably get away with 8-10%.

Filament: Overture PLA White


Notes:

Pretty easy to print, I designed it to be. On this version (as compared to the prototype shown in photos above) I've changed a little bit of the geometry around the nut pocket to make it easier to get the nuts into position when clamping the thing down, which requires a little bit in the way of supports. Otherwise, by and large you can print this in the orientation that the STLs come in, with whatever your preferred settings are, and it'll come out just fine.

I just checked my old gcode for the prototype and my new gcode for this model, and they come out to 240 grams and 220 grams respectively. The first one is quite sturdy, and I expect most of the savings from this improved model come from reducing the extra material on the logo side and making the geometry around the line captures a little more sensible. (edit: nevermind, looks like I just had a bad print orientation on the first one which made a lot of extra support, the two should be very close in weight) The existing one is quite sturdy, and I expect the second one to be more of the same.
